E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
+StringBuilder
知识体系总结(五)java基础、集合、并发、JVM
String,StringBuffer,
StringBuilder
的区别是什么?静态内部类和非静态内部类的区别java面向对象的三大特性访问权限关键字Public、prot
椛丿未眠”
·
2023-12-06 10:16
Java
知识体系总结
java
jvm
开发语言
Kotlin 函数5 - 扩展函数
Integer等)添加自定义的扩展方法例如:给String添加一个扩展方法,将创建的字符串本身复制n遍,并将其返回funString.multiple(times:Int):String{valsb=
StringBuilder
ChenME
·
2023-12-06 07:16
【无标题】
可以使用
StringBuilder
或StringBuffer来进行可变的字符串操作。3.什么是Java的自动装箱和拆箱?答案:自动装箱是指将原始类型自动转换为相应
CrazyMax_zh
·
2023-12-05 11:07
面试
开发语言
java
Java生成四位数验证码
publicstaticStringverification(){Stringlist="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789";
StringBuilder
sb
java牛虻
·
2023-12-04 11:48
java
开发语言
java面经1day
String,StringBuffer,
StringBuilder
的区别从俩方面开始下手是否可变是否安全回答:String是final实现,其为不可变长,每次变长都会新增对象。
koshi484
·
2023-12-04 10:00
java
开发语言
Java基础(1)——数据类型&包装类,引用类型String&
StringBuilder
,正则表达式,定点数,日期类
目录引出一、基本数据类型1.byte2.short3.int类型4.char类型5.Long常量默认类型及类型描述浮点型布尔型boolean二、引用数据类型String1.String类型(重要)1)如何比较两个字符串是否相等?2)常用方法2.String的创建【常量池】1)Stringstr=newString("hello");2)Stringstr="hello";3.String的特点【内
Perley620
·
2023-12-04 09:04
Java
java
学习
jvm
java学习part32StringBuffer和
StringBuilder
Java中的值传递和引用传递(详解)-知乎(zhihu.com)146-常用类与基础API-StringBuffer与
StringBuilder
的源码分析、常用方法_哔哩哔哩_bilibili1.2.扩容机制不够用
BigOrangeSama
·
2023-12-03 22:04
java
java
学习
开发语言
java学习part31String
API-String的理解与不可变性_哔哩哔哩_bilibili1.String2.字符串常量池变更储存区的原因是加快被gc的频率==比地址,equals比内容3.字符串连接s3s4都是字符串常量,后面几个会利用
StringBuilder
BigOrangeSama
·
2023-12-03 22:02
java
学习
面试题库之JAVA基础篇(二)
每次+操作会隐式的在内存中new一个跟原字符串一样的
StringBuilder
对象,然后append+号后面的字符串。
StringBuilder
可变字符串对象。线程不安全。
小花卷的dad
·
2023-12-03 22:32
JAVA面试题库
面试
java
职场和发展
java链式编程/级联式编程
举例:
StringBuilder
builder=new
StringBuilder
(96);builder.append("
菠萝科技
·
2023-12-03 22:18
java·未分类
java8/9/11
设计模式
链式
编程
builder
java
lombok
2018-09-27
3、String,Stringbuffer,
StringBuilder
的区别。4、ArrayList和LinkedList有什么区别。
时乆
·
2023-12-03 17:04
浦发银行上机代码整理
浦发银行上机代码整理回文数相加输入2,输出1+121;privatestaticintaddBackNumber(intn){if(n==1)return1;
StringBuilder
list=new
StringBuilder
&orange
·
2023-12-03 14:42
面试算法
深入理解StringBuffer和
StringBuilder
StringBuffer和
StringBuilder
在Java中,StringBuffer和
StringBuilder
都是用于处理和操作字符串的类,它们都提供了一系列的方法和功能,如拼接、插入、删除等。
无问287
·
2023-12-03 11:37
Java
java
开发语言
代码随想录算法训练营第三十七天 _ 贪心算法_738.单调自增的数字、968.监督二叉树
入如:322classSolution{//java中的String不能修改,需要
StringBuilder
。
Josue?
·
2023-12-02 23:39
刷题训练心得
算法
贪心算法
java之
StringBuilder
在Java中,
StringBuilder
类是一个可变对象,用于处理字符串。
沐暖沐
·
2023-12-02 06:56
java
python
前端
线程安全与线程不安全的一些理解
我们经常说,StringBuffer是线程安全的,
StringBuilder
是线程不安全的,这里的线程安全与不安全,指的是在代码没有bug的情况下多线程操作同一个StringBuffer不会出现预料之外的状况
猫尾草
·
2023-12-01 14:30
[Java 基础 - 知识点]
数据类型包装类型缓存池String概览不可变的好处String,StringBufferand
StringBuilder
String.intern()运算参数传递float与double隐式类型转换switch
奥耶可乐冰
·
2023-12-01 13:00
Java
java
开发语言
DbHelper DataSet转List DataTable转List
1、打印列名和数据类型publicIHttpActionResultGetColumn(stringname){
StringBuilder
strSql=new
StringBuilder
();strSql.Append
KingCruel
·
2023-12-01 10:33
.Net技术
c#
linq
开发语言
专升本三本计科仔学习Java到实习之路 1
韩顺平视频P1记录1.第一阶段:建立编程思想2.第二阶段:提升编程能力注:
stringbuilder
是面试官最喜欢问的问题3.分析需求,实现代码能力学完网络编程这里暂停,得要学其他的了注:Lambda函数演算跳过
Doge很紧张
·
2023-12-01 10:09
学习
Java选择题简单的考试系统
Java选择题简单的考试系统做前声明:此系统包括了Java中:面向对象-封装、String-
StringBuilder
、ArrayList集合、继承-抽象-final、static-接口-多态、四大权限符
一天不出bug就难受
·
2023-12-01 10:00
java
java第十六课
NewString(“a”)+newString(“b”)---à
StringBuilder
concat开辟一个两个字符长度的空间,把两个字符串连接在一起方法:isEmpty判空length()长度,调用数组的属性
qq我爱学习
·
2023-12-01 06:01
java
算法
数据结构
Java中Cron表达式的生成解析和计算的工具类
完整代码本文介绍通过java生成cron表达式,解析表达式,计算表达式执行日期1.生成表达式publicstaticStringcreateCronExpression(CronModelcronModel){
StringBuilder
cronExp
*郑*
·
2023-12-01 05:20
java
面试
java
python
算法
Android TextView局部文字颜色不一样,并实现点击事件
您也可以切换到心愿大厅去寻找简单容易获得的商品"valtextClickable="切换到心愿大厅"valtvTip:TextView=contentView.findViewById(R.id.tv_tip)valssb=Spannable
StringBuilder
晚安08
·
2023-12-01 02:59
Kotlin
Android
android
kotlin
Android TextView 部分文字点击与变色
Spannable
StringBuilder
style=newSpannable
StringBuilder
("同意阅读以下协议《用户使用协议》和《隐私协议》");style.setSpan(newForegroundColorSpan
缥缈神
·
2023-12-01 02:56
android
Java常考知识点
笔记内容文章目录一、java的基本数据类型与包装类二、final修饰变量类方法三、String为什么是不可变的,以及newString(“abc”)创建了几个对象四、String、StringBuffer、以及
StringBuilder
java满杯百香果
·
2023-11-30 20:00
java基础
java
数据结构(逻辑结构,物理结构,特点) C#多线程编程的同步也线程安全 C#多线程编程笔记 String 与
StringBuilder
(StringBuffer) 数据结构与算法-初体验(极...
数据结构(逻辑结构,物理结构,特点)一、数据的逻辑结构:指反映数据元素之间的逻辑关系的数据结构,其中的逻辑关系是指数据元素之间的前后件关系,而与他们在计算机中的存储位置无关。逻辑结构包括:集合数据结构中的元素之间除了“同属一个集合”的相互关系外,别无其他关系;2.线性结构数据结构中的元素存在一对一的相互关系;3.树形结构数据结构中的元素存在一对多的相互关系;4.图形结构数据结构中的元素存在多对多的
anmei1912
·
2023-11-30 17:16
c#
数据结构与算法
后端
String 、StringBuffer 和
StringBuilder
的区别?
String使用String声明一个字符串的时候,该字符串会存放在堆中的字符串常量池中。因为在java中所有的String都是以常量表示,且由final修饰,因此在线程池中它的线程是安全的且不可变的。每个String在被创建后就不再发生任何变化。我们在创建String的时候,它在常量池中对这些信息进行处理,如果程序中出现了大量字符串拼接、划分等操作效率将非常低。因此,使用场景是在少量字符串操作的时
dx1313113
·
2023-11-30 17:37
Java
java
开发语言
字符串可变不可变
不可变字符串在同一个地址的情况下数据不能被改变可变字符串
StringBuilder
在
StringBuilder
这个对象地址值不变的情况下,改变数据是可能的,用append直接追加即可对象始终指向value
吃炒鸡蛋
·
2023-11-30 09:59
java
【Java SE】带你在String类世界中遨游!!!
String类的重要性2.String类常用方法2.1字符串构造2.2String对象的比较2.3字符串查找2.4转化2.5字符串替换2.6字符串拆分2.7字符串截取2.8字符串的不可变性2.11字符串修改3.
StringBuilder
《黑巧克力》
·
2023-11-30 02:32
java
java
开发语言
数据库
git
开源
StringBuilder
解析
StringBuilder
和StringBuffer的构造器和方法基本相同,StringBuffer是线程安全的,
StringBuilder
非线程安全。
骆驼整理说
·
2023-11-29 17:01
Java基础
java
spring
JDK 21 新特性一览
StringTemplates(Preview)字符串模板,可以像其他语言那样子方便的做字符串拼接,是+号,
StringBuilder
,MessageFormat之外更方便的字符串拼接方法。
一码归一码@
·
2023-11-29 14:01
Java基础理论
java
开发语言
String
StringBuilder
的使用案例
Java字符串的一个重要特点就是字符串不可变。publicclassMain{publicstaticvoidmain(String[]args){Strings="Hello";System.out.println(s);//输出Hellos=s.toUpperCase();System.out.println(s);//经过上面的字母全部大写的函数处理,结果仍然是Hello}}java_str
lookphp
·
2023-11-29 11:56
java开发两年,你知道StringBuffer的扩容原理吗?来看看阿里大牛是怎么讲的吧
为了解决这个问题,我们需要用到StringBuffer类和
StringBuilder
类。这两个类可牛逼了,它们都是可变长度的字符串类,在字符串的拼接处理上大大提高了效率。
程序员匡胤
·
2023-11-29 03:54
Java-认识String类
本章重点:1.认识String类2.了解String类的基本用法3.熟练掌握String类的常见操作4.认识字符串常量池5.认识StringBuffer和
StringBuilder
1.String类的重要性在
小凡喜编程
·
2023-11-28 17:35
Java
java
开发语言
实例6 -
StringBuilder
和StringBuffer转成String
Java中字符操作可使用
StringBuilder
(线程不安全),StringBuffer(线程安全)以及String.其中String值不可变,因此在字符操作比如字符串拼接,截取等等,底层JVM处理时
静筱
·
2023-11-27 16:45
Java研学-StringBuffer与
StringBuilder
一StringBuffer与
StringBuilder
1关于Buffer/Buffered 缓冲(缓存)技术:由于String类底层实现是char[],数组一旦创建长度固定,不利于String类数据的增删改查操作
泰勒疯狂展开
·
2023-11-27 09:57
#
Java研学
java
开发语言
信息安全技术-(java实现)凯撒密码及仿射密码的加密解密
逻辑代码(加密解密函数):/***明文进行加密**@paramword明文*@paramx位移的长度*@return密文*/publicStringEncryWord(Stringword,intx){
StringBuilder
sb
群玉山头见
·
2023-11-27 06:22
信息安全技术
密码学
leetcode中“辅助栈”类题目和“单调栈”类题目的异同
普通辅助栈classSolution{publicStringremoveDuplicates(Strings,intk){intn=s.length();char[]cs=s.toCharArray();
StringBuilder
res
xxx_520s
·
2023-11-27 05:21
数据结构
leetcode
算法
java
String,StringBuffer以及
StringBuilder
之间的区别
文章目录区别一:字符串内容是否可变区别二:线程安全区别三:性能区别四:使用场景“String,StringBuffer以及
StringBuilder
之间的区别的区别”这个问题是面试官比较常问的一个Java
十七号程序猿
·
2023-11-27 02:18
Java面试题汇总
Java
java
开发语言
Java(五)(Object类,克隆,Objects类,包装类,
StringBuilder
,StringJoiner,BigDecimal)
目录Object类Object类的常见方法:克隆浅克隆深克隆Objects类包装类
StringBuilder
StringJoinerBigDecimalObject类Object类是java中的祖宗类,
Alan Frank
·
2023-11-26 12:51
java
开发语言
针对String、StringBuffer、
Stringbuilder
区别及使用场景
StringBuilder
:字符串生成器,是可变的。它允许在字符串中插入、追加、删除字符等操作,而不会创建新的对象。它的性能比String好,但不是线程安全的。
达芬奇要当程序员
·
2023-11-26 12:57
Java
java
开发语言
String和StringBuffer、
StringBuilder
的区别?字符型常量和字符串常量的区别;String 是最基本的数据类型吗?String 类的常用方法都有那些?
文章目录String、StringBuffer、
StringBuilder
字符型常量和字符串常量的区别什么是字符串常量池?
皮皮攻城狮
·
2023-11-26 11:23
Java
java
多线程(初阶四:synchronized关键字)
针对加锁操作的一些混淆理解(1)多个线程调用同一个类的方法,对其方法里面的变量加锁(2)Test类里的add方法里面,加锁的对象换成Test.class四、联系其他的相关知识点1、StringBuffer和
StringBuilder
2
tao滔不绝
·
2023-11-26 08:09
java
开发语言
java-ee
28-01:写个函数,可以转化下划线命名到驼峰命名
publicstaticStringUnderlineToHump(Stringpara){
StringBuilder
result=new
StringBuilder
();Stringa[]=para.split
小小前端搬运工
·
2023-11-26 03:33
java3-5年面试题——基础篇
1.String,
StringBuilder
,StringBuffer区别是什么?底层数据结构是什么?分别是如何实现的?String直接实现了CharSequence接口,一旦创建不可变。
若久2023
·
2023-11-25 19:17
散列表
java
02_使用API_String
StringBuilder
StringBuilder
代表可变字符串对象,相对于是一个容器,它里面装的字符串是可以改变的,就是用来操作字符串的好处:
StringBuilder
比String更适合做字符串的修改操作
-seventy-
·
2023-11-25 16:09
Java中级
java
高级Java程序面试问题整理
Object常见方法Java中数据结构Java中异常处理访问控制修饰符==与equals区别重写equals方法,为什么要重写hashcodefinal关键字的一些总结String和StringBuffer、
StringBuilder
爱折腾的Albert
·
2023-11-25 08:44
Java
面试题
java
多线程
并发
面试大全
Android Spannable 使用注意事项
1、当前示例中间的"评论",使用Spannable
StringBuilder
实现,点击评论会有高亮效果加粗,但再点击其它Bar时无法恢复默认样式。
韩老九
·
2023-11-25 06:02
Android
android
SpannableString
ORM框架SqlSugar安装及使用(连接MySql)
二、使用1、获取连接字符串示例代码:publicstaticstringGetConStr(){varbuilder=newMySqlConnection
StringBuilder
(){Server="
一介学徒
·
2023-11-25 02:49
mysql
数据库
c#
Java字符串拼接
号操作符是字符串拼接最常用的一种了Stringstr1="爱星星的";Stringstr2="阿狸";System.out.println(str1+str2);把这段代码使用JAD反编译原来编译的时候把“+”号操作符替换成了
StringBuilder
盼旺
·
2023-11-24 13:53
上一页
3
4
5
6
7
8
9
10
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他